You can book a home-visit from one of our engineers who will:
– Produce a domestic energy audit using rdSAP (the government approved methodology) which will show your existing carbon footprint (how much energy your home uses) and give your property an energy rating from A–G.

– Tell you how to reduce your carbon emissions, save money on your bills and improve your overall energy rating.

– Price-up the cost of these recommendations. We will offer a range of suggestions from changes in behaviour through to the installation of major renewable products where applicable.

– Install and then maintain any or all of these recommendations.
